Hamas releases 4 Israeli Women to the last removal of cessation of fire



Palestinian militant group Hamas has liberated four Israeli female soldiers who were held in the Gaza Strip as part of the last Fire cessation agreementAccording to the Israeli military.

In return, the Jewish state released 70 Palestinian prisoners.

Israeli defense forces (IDF) said that women will undergo medical evaluations once they arrive in Israel and will meet with their families.

“Our mission is not over until each hostage arrives home,” spokesman for IDF Daniel Hagari he said In a video recorded on Saturday.

The Israeli military identified the four women such as Karina Ariev, Daniella Gilboa, Naama Levy and Liri Albag. A fifth soldier was also in his unit, Agam Berger, 20, but he was not included in the list, according to The associated press.

Female soldiers were abducted from Nahal Oz’s base during October 7, 2023, the terrorist attack on Israel, which caused war in the region after more than 1,200 Israelis were killed and about 250 people took hostage. .

Israel responded with a bombing campaign that has killed more than 47,000 Palestinians in Gaza, according to local health officials. The account does not distinguish between civilians and fighters.

The last publication of prisoners is part of a six -week cessation agreement between Israel and Hamas that was reached 10 days ago, bringing the two parts closer to the battle that have been in progress for the last 15 months. The agreement officially came into force Last Sunday, after the approval of the Israeli government.

The exchange exceeds the number of Israelis released to seven, as they were already three hostages: Romi Gonen, Doron Steinbrecher and Emily Damari – liberated As part of the agreement last weekend.

The Israeli army will retire from the central part of the Gaza Strip as part of the fire cessation agreement, allowing thousands of Palestinians to return home. The development seems to be suspended until the Israelis can recover Arbel Yehud, one of Hamas’ last civil women, according to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u.

More than 100 captives were also released during a truce all week In 2023.
